History shows that small towns with presidential ties can stay on the map long after the president has gone. Take Hyde Park, New York, for instance. It sits on the Hudson River and draws tourists year-round to visit Franklin D. Roosevelt's presidential library, home, and gravesite. In Tampico, Illinois, signs advertise the town as Ronald Reagan's birthplace, encouraging travelers to make a brief stop on their way to Chicago.
Plains has its own unique charm. It's a place where you can still feel the echoes of history. The town is hoping that even without President Carter, people will continue to visit, curious to explore his roots and the story of a small-town boy who became the leader of the free world.
